Output 3d109e599f5b13a432634725c273e1c3118b92a0ec8f9ab8fb47d2e2243ad00e:2

value
58837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 292aba56fe015fa765acdc1b212d9f589dafacf9 OP_EQUAL
address
MBeq85eygFgLg5SF2M73ZfoD9iPZtpo7fL
transaction
3d109e599f5b13a432634725c273e1c3118b92a0ec8f9ab8fb47d2e2243ad00e
spent
true